Biography

Sophomore (2011)

HogenEsch came off the bench in six games for Emory during hersophomore campaign.  She took seven shots, one of which was ongoal.  HogenEsch registered six of her shots during theEagles' 6-0 win over Agnes Scott College on September 28th.

Freshman (2010):

HogenEsch appeared in three games off the bench for Emory duringher freshman season.

Prior to Emory:

Played on the West Lafayette Junior/ Senior High School women'ssoccer team for four seasons, serving as the team's captain duringher senior campaign... Earned Academic All-Americaand All-State honors... Scored 49 goals during her high schoolcareer, including 29 during the 2007 season... Coached by JamesHunter in high school... Also played club soccer for the CarmelUnited Soccer Club, where she was coached by Terri St. John.

Personal:

Born April 3, 1992... Was a National Merit Scholar and an honorroll student in high school.
